Elevated requirement?
#1
When a user opens VisionApp 2015 elevated, they get the list of SQL environments available. All new users see the same thing.

When they load it without elevation, it shows "there is no environment configured right now. Please add a new environment to start working". Only if I add it to their machine manually do they then see it in the future.

Is there a workaround for this, or do users have to open VisionApp elevated (as administrator) to see the databases setup and not have to re-add them?

I'd much prefer NOT to have this.

Seems to be a problem with user rights - the database environments are normally stored under "Program Data / All Users"-Profile - if the users do not have access to this folder they can't read the environments from this location - perhaps it's an option to use command line option - you can store your environments file in any other folder and start ASG-RD with command line option to open a specific environments.xml file
